Job Overview:
Passionate in analyzing performance bottlenecks and driving architectural improvements?
Eager to expand into building SoC platforms for performance analysis?
Arm's System-on-Chip (SoC) Performance Analysis Team in Central Technology Group builds early Performance analysis platforms to enable system technology exploration on future Arm System/SoC architecture. Using workload characterization and analysis, we influence future SoC, CPU and IP designs. We are seeking highly skilled and motivated performance analysis engineers to join our diverse team at Arm!
Responsibilities:
As a Performance verification and Emulation engineer you will be working on multiple aspects of performance analysis, including:
• Perform RTL performance analysis and verification for SoC
• Provide technical leadership while collaborating closely with architecture, design, and modeling teams on high-performance SoC
• Execute performance verification plans at SoC-level and performance debug using both simulation and emulation environments.
• Drive emulation-based performance studies, including emulator bring-up and execution of complex, system-level benchmarks.
• Conduct theoretical analysis of memory system optimizations; develop, run, and analyze benchmarks in simulation and/or emulation environments.
• Debug performance failures, identify design bottlenecks, and propose data-driven architectural or RTL solutions.
• Develop and enhance debug infrastructure, tooling, and visualization solutions to accelerate performance analysis and root-cause identification.
• Leverage AI-based tools and automation to improve engineering productivity and performance analysis workflows.
• Mentor and guide junior engineers, contributing to the technical growth and effectiveness of the team.
Required Skills and Experience:
• Proven experience in SoC RTL performance analysis and debug using hardware emulation platforms.
• Hands-on experience with emulator bring-up, configuration, and development of new performance test cases.
• Strong system-level performance debug experience across complex IP interactions, including CPU, GPU, and I/O workloads.
• Deep understanding of memory system architecture and interconnect design.
• Excellent knowledge of Verilog and SystemVerilog.
• Working knowledge of C, C++, and a scripting language such as Python or Ruby.
• Solid understanding of multiprocessor coherency, memory ordering, I/O ordering, interrupts, MMU, and cache architectures.
• Strong debugging, data analysis, and technical presentation skills.
"Nice To Have" Skills and Experience:
• Proficiency in Unix/Linux, scripting, and source control systems (e.g., Git, Subversion).
• Familiarity with one or more CPU instruction sets
• Familiarity with SystemVerilog
• Familiarity with ARM architecture
• Experience with compilers, assemblers, or device drivers.

What you need to know about the Charlotte Tech Scene
Ranked among the hottest tech cities in 2024 by CompTIA, Charlotte is quickly cementing its place as a major U.S. tech hub. Home to more than 90,000 tech workers, the city’s ecosystem is primed for continued growth, fueled by billions in annual funding from heavyweights like Microsoft and RevTech Labs, which has created thousands of fintech jobs and made the city a go-to for tech pros looking for their next big opportunity.
Key Facts About Charlotte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 90,859; 6.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Lowe’s, Bank of America, TIAA, Microsoft, Honeywell
- Key Industries: Fintech,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, cloud computing, e-commerce
-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(CED)
- Notable Investors: Microsoft, Google, Falfurrias Management Partners, RevTech Labs Foundation
- Research Centers and Universities: University of North Carolina at Charlotte, Northeastern University, North Carolina Research Campus
